I’m Not Who I Was β€” Grief, Motherhood, and Identity After Stillbirth

I’m Not Who I Was β€” Grief, Motherhood, and Identity After Stillbirth


Episode 81


Todays episode

In this episode of the Pregnancy, Loss, and Motherhood podcast, host Vallen Webb explores the profound impact of stillbirth on a mother's identity. She discusses the emotional journey of reclaiming oneself after loss, the struggle to trust one's body again, and the unique experience of mothering a child who is no longer here. Vallen emphasizes the importance of building a new identity with intention and the pressure many feel to return to their pre-loss selves. Through personal anecdotes and reflections, she encourages listeners to honor their past selves while embracing the transformation that comes with grief and motherhood.

Takeaways

  • Motherhood changes identity drastically, especially after loss.
  • It's common to feel erased after becoming a mother.
  • Trust in one's body can be shattered by stillbirth.
  • Mothering a baby that is not here is a unique challenge.
  • The pressure to bounce back after loss is overwhelming.
  • The version of you before loss may not exist anymore.
  • You can decide who you want to be after loss.
  • Mindset work is crucial for rebuilding identity.
  • Every choice contributes to building a new self.
  • You are not broken; you are becoming.
